    As it appears the GX640 isn't going to be released in the UK, it appears the Kolbalt G860 will be my next best bet.

    Has anyone had experience with this machine/ company.

    G860
    Screen - :: 15.6" 1600x900 HD+ X-Glass
    Processor - :: Intel® Core i5 520M Dual Core with HT 2.66GHz - 2.93GHz 3MB Cache
    Video Card - :: ATI Mobility Radeon HD 5870 1GB GDDR5
    Memory 1 - :: 4GB DDR3 1333Mhz CAS9 2x 2GB DIMMs
    Hard Drive - :: 320GB 7,200rpm SATA-II with 16MB Cache
    Operating system 1 - :: Windows 7 Home Premium 32-bit
    Optical Device 1 - :: 8x DVD±R/W
    Bluetooth - :: Bluetooth V2.0 Module
    7 in 1 card reader - :: 7 in 1 card reader
    Warranty - :: 2 Year - European Collect & Return

    This comes to £1220 (inc delivery), which is about £200 more (and £200 more than i wanted to pay) than the G640.

    I believe the G860 has;
    -Better cooling
    -Backlit keyboard
    -Slightly better graphics card
    -Faster processor
    -Faster ram

    Is there anything I've missed that would make me press the button?
